Event 12: Two Million Chip Man

$170 + $30 Deep Stack Double Play NLH (2 Re-entry)

The two big stacks on table two were bound to get into a confrontation eventually.  It just happened on the turn with a board of T 3 2 T.  All the chips went in the pot.  Anthony Maio (Jamison, PA) held 54 and had flopped a flush with straight-flush re-draw.  Ryan Eriquezzo held pocket 9s (two pair) and was drawing thin (4 outs).

It helps to run good.  The river delivered the T, giving Ryan Tens-full of 9s to beat Anthony's flush.  The stacks were close and had to be counted down, but Ryan had more and in the end, collected the huge pot.  He's now sitting behind ~2 million and leading the field.

Anthony Maio headed for the payout desk.
